Social Life Opportunities (solo)

Also known as: Solihull Leisure Opportunities, Solihull Life Opportunities, Solo Life Opportunities, Solo Life Opportunities (solo), Solo

Provision of leisure/social activities for children/adults with learning disabilities living within Solihull or the surrounding areas. Provision of respite to the parents/carers of children and adults with learning disabilites receiving our leisure services. Support to other local organisations providing services to children/adults with LD. Provision of volunteering opportunities.

Frequently asked questions about Social Life Opportunities (solo)

What does Social Life Opportunities (solo) do?

Provision of leisure/social activities for children/adults with learning disabilities living within Solihull or the surrounding areas. Provision of respite to the parents/carers of children and adults with learning disabilites receiving our leisure services. Support to other local organisations providing services to children/adults with LD. Provision of volunteering opportunities.

How much income did Social Life Opportunities (solo) report in 2025?

Social Life Opportunities (solo) reported total income of £2.32m and reported expenditure of £2.26m for the financial year ending 2025, based on the most recent annual return filed with the Charity Commission.

How efficient is Social Life Opportunities (solo)?

Social Life Opportunities (solo) has a program ratio of 97.2%, meaning that share of its income goes directly to charitable activities. This is higher than 61% of UK Beneficiary group charities with income £1M to £10M (sample of 3130 charities). See our methodology for how this is calculated.

When was Social Life Opportunities (solo) registered as a charity?

Social Life Opportunities (solo) was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 25 February 2004 as charity number 1102297. It has been registered for 22 years.

Who runs Social Life Opportunities (solo)?

Social Life Opportunities (solo) is governed by a board of 7 trustees. The chair of trustees is Janet PRIOR. Trustees are legally responsible for the charity's governance and are listed in full on its profile.

Where does Social Life Opportunities (solo) operate?

Social Life Opportunities (solo) operates across 3 areas: Birmingham City, Solihull and Warwickshire.

Is Social Life Opportunities (solo) a registered charity?

Yes — Social Life Opportunities (solo) is a registered charity in England and Wales, charity number 1102297.
